0913 GMT - European defense stocks rose in early morning trade following the likely Republican victory in the U.S. presidential election. German arms makers Hensoldt and Rheinmetall led the increases, with shares advancing 8% at 34.38 euros, and 4.2% at 500.6 euros respectively. The U.K.'s BAE Systems is up 4.2% at 13.34 pounds, followed by Italy's Leonardo, which is up 3.9% at 24.45 euros. Shares in French aerospace and defense group Thales rose 3% at 154.45 euros.
